The Power and Water Footprint
AI data centers consume a staggering amount of electricity—some estimates suggest they account for roughly 4% of U.S. electricity usage in 2024. Even more eye‑watering is their water usage. Reports indicate that certain facilities draw as many as 5 million gallons of water per day to keep servers cool. Those figures vary by site, and exact consumption often remains undisclosed, but the scale is clear.

"We cannot ignore the reality that our water tables are being strained, and our electric bills are rising because of these data centers," says Maya Ramirez, a community organizer in a Midwestern town.
Local Utility Costs Rise
When a data center demands large amounts of power, local utilities must scale up supply or purchase additional wholesale energy. In several states, the cost of electricity for residents has risen by as much as 15% in the last two years—a figure that correlates strongly with the construction of new AI hubs. Some municipalities have even had to renegotiate rate structures to accommodate the additional load, often at the expense of schools and public services.
Environmental Concerns
Beyond water and power, the environmental footprint of these centers is a major point of contention. Cooling towers release hot air, increasing local temperatures, while the construction itself can disrupt ecosystems. Grassroots groups argue that the carbon emissions associated with powering vast server farms, many of which are built in remote but ecologically sensitive areas, outweigh the potential benefits.

The Organizing Response
One of the most striking aspects of the backlash has been the speed and unity of the response. Community groups have forged broad coalitions, setting aside political differences to focus on shared concerns: water protection, utility fairness, and ecological stewardship. In some regions, activists have organized public hearings and petition drives, while others lobby state legislatures for stricter environmental oversight.
A Blueprint for the Future
New York recently paused the approval of a proposed AI data center, citing community input and a comprehensive review of environmental impacts. The decision has been hailed as a blueprint for other states. While some tech firms claim that their operations bring jobs and revenue, many residents weigh those benefits against the long-term sustainability of their neighborhoods.
